About The Position

This is a non-supervisory position. Under general supervision, the Water/Wastewater Plant Operator will operate, monitor, maintain, and trouble-shoot the wastewater treatment facility and its processes. The primary function of this position is to maintain and operate the city's water/wastewater production, treatment, and storage in a safe, effective, and efficient manner Work involves responsibility for the technical aspects of plant operations, compliance with state and federal operating regulations, and underground sewer system. Work is performed with considerable independence under the direction of the Senior Operator or Water/Wastewater Plant Superintendent, subject to review through reports and results achieved.

Responsibilities

  • Checks chemical levels at regular intervals.
  • Run routine laboratory tests to determine proper chemical treatment.
  • Collect water samples.
  • Check operation of equipment in plant and make repairs or reports of defects.
  • Backwash filters at regular intervals to ensure proper flow and drain sludge from bottom of basins as needed.
  • Maintains plant records.
  • Cleans and maintains facilities and grounds.
  • May assist with preparation of monthly, quarterly, or annual reports to State and Federal agencies.
  • Assists in the installation, maintenance and repair of City water/wastewater utilities to include water pipes, water pumps and water main systems.
  • Answers emergency calls from the public and other agencies taking appropriate action such as repairs to water/wastewater system.
